ABSTRACT Aim To evaluate bone level changes in implants with 1‐mm‐ or 3‐mm‐high abutments over a 7‐year period and to investigate the role of abutment height upon peri‐implant status. Materials and Methods Two‐piece implants were placed 1.5 mm subcrestally with either 1‐mm (control) or 3‐mm (test) high definitive abutments. Marginal bone level change from the first to seventh year was the primary outcome. Peri‐implant status and other patient and peri‐implant clinical variables (smoking, peri‐implant maintenance therapy compliance, interproximal hygiene, vertical soft tissue thickness and keratinised mucosa width) were also assessed. Results After 7 years, 37 subjects (63 implants) were analysed: 17 subjects with 32 implants in the 1‐mm abutment group, and 20 subjects with 31 implants in the 3‐mm abutment group. Significant differences in marginal bone level changes were observed at 7 years. The 3‐mm abutment group showed smaller changes compared to the 1‐mm abutment group at mesial sites (−0.27 ± 1.32 mm vs. −0.42 ± 0.50 mm, respectively) and distal sites (−0.33 ± 1.39 mm vs. −0.35 ± 0.38 mm), with both differences being statistically significant ( p < 0.001). In the control group, 18 implants (54.6%) presented peri‐implant mucositis and 6 implants (18.2%) showed peri‐implantitis. In the test group, 23 implants (74.2%) presented peri‐implant mucositis and 1 implant (3.2%) showed peri‐implantitis. No statistically significant differences were found ( p = 0.158). Conclusions Subcrestally inserted implants with 3‐mm definitive abutments experienced minimal bone loss over long‐term follow‐up compared to 1‐mm abutments. However, since the differences were not statistically significant, no conclusions could be drawn on the protective effect against peri‐implantitis.
